Output 7e88bf041194c1fd6da64dfe8fc76f6cc78a382233982dce82c6fa7f3773c7f8:1

value
58812158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6eebbb592e68ab4c37ce7c43f17cfa5f6971e8b OP_EQUAL
address
3MHUX57ZKQLv8VX1BrNLH7RQjKxZDDj2jR
transaction
7e88bf041194c1fd6da64dfe8fc76f6cc78a382233982dce82c6fa7f3773c7f8
confirmations
325247
spent
true